UserPlus <= 2.0 - Authenticated (Editor+) Registration Form Update to Privilege Escalation

Incorrect Privilege Assignment
CVE CVE-2024-9519
CVSS High (7.2)
Publicly Published October 9, 2024
Last Updated October 10, 2024
Researcher István Márton
Description

The UserPlus pl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ized modification of data due to an improper capability check on the 'save_metabox_form' function in versions up to, and including, 2.0.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with editor-level permissions or above, to update the registration form role to administrator, which leads to privilege escalation.
